 In honor of its 20th anniversary, Razer is reviving the Boomslang gaming mouse

The first dedicated gaming mouse in history, the Boomslang, was introduced back in 1999, when Razer was a subsidiary of Karna LLC. In 2005, Razer became an independent company, and now, to mark the 20th anniversary of this event, it is releasing an updated version of the iconic mouse in a limited edition of 1,337 copies.

 Finalmouse has released the Centerpiece keyboard with an under-key display

After its initial announcement in 2022, Finalmouse has finally brought the Centerpiece keyboard to market and announced the start of sales. Its distinctive features are a built-in processor and a large display located directly under the keys.

 Logitech has released a wireless mechanical keyboard with 12 months of battery life

Logitech has introduced the Alto Keys K98M mechanical keyboard to the international market. In addition to its original design and hot-swappable switches, this new product offers impressive battery life.
